Summary

Environment and Public Works is a standing committee of the U.S. Senate with 4 subcommittees and 18 members. It has 282 bills before it this session and has held 22 hearings.


Chair

Chair: Sen. Shelley Capito (R-WV). Ranking Member: Sen. Sheldon Whitehouse (D-RI). Online at epw.senate.gov/public.

Environment and Public Works has 282 bills, 67 meetings and 0 reports on the record this session.

History

The committee has carried 2 names since Aug 2, 1946, established by 60 S 2177.

NameFromToAuthority
Committee on Environment and Public WorksFeb 4, 1977Present95 S Res 4
Committee on Public WorksAug 2, 1946Feb 4, 197760 S 2177
